Title: Clam Chowder (Red Lobster)
Yield: 6 Servings

Ingredients

      1    van geffen vghc
      1 qt clam juice
      1 c  non-fat dry milk powder
    2/3 c  flour
     14 oz can chicken broth
      2    ribs celery -- chop fine
      1 tb dry minced onion
     10 oz can clams -- minced well

Instructions

pn Dry parsley flakes 2 Baked potatoes; cook, peel -crumbled In blender
put clam juice, milk powder and flour, blending smooth. Pour into 2-1/2 qt
saucepan and stir in chicken broth, stirring constantly on medium-high heat
until thick and smooth. Turn heat to low. Stir in celery, onions, clams,
parsley and potatoes. Keep on low heat up to an hour and season with salt
and pepper. Freezes well. Source: Gloria Pitzer's Secret Recipes
Newsletter.
